R语言读写xlsx文件
时间: 2024-01-25 19:09:23 浏览: 136
在R语言中,你可以使用`readxl`包来读取和写入xlsx文件。首先,你需要确保已经安装了`readxl`包。如果没有安装,可以使用以下命令进行安装:
```R
install.packages("readxl")
```
读取xlsx文件的示例代码如下:
```R
library(readxl)
# 读取xlsx文件
data <- read_excel("path/to/file.xlsx")
# 查看数据
head(data)
```
其中,"path/to/file.xlsx"是要读取的文件路径。读取后的数据将存储在`data`变量中。
写入xlsx文件的示例代码如下:
```R
library(readxl)
# 创建一个数据框
data <- data.frame(col1 = c(1, 2, 3),
col2 = c("A", "B", "C"))
# 写入xlsx文件
write_excel_csv(data, "path/to/file.xlsx")
```
其中,`data`是要写入的数据框,"path/to/file.xlsx"是要写入的文件路径。
相关问题
r语言加载xlsx函数
要在R语言加载xlsx函数,需要先安装并加载“xlsx”包。可以使用以下代码安装和加载该包:
```R
# 安装xlsx包
install.packages("xlsx")
# 加载xlsx包
library(xlsx)
```
然后就可以使用xlsx包中的函数读写Excel文件。例如,使用read.xlsx函数读取Excel文件:
```R
# 读取Excel文件
data <- read.xlsx("path/to/file.xlsx", sheetName = "Sheet1")
```
其中,“path/to/file.xlsx”是Excel文件的路径,“Sheet1”是要读取的工作表的名称。
r语言xlsx包总出错误
r语言xlsx包是一个用于读写Excel文件的R软件包,如果你在使用它时遇到了错误,可能是由于以下原因之一:
1. 文件路径错误:在读取或写入文件时,需要确保文件路径是正确的,否则会出现错误。请确保你提供的文件路径是正确的。
2. 文件格式错误:xlsx包只支持读取和写入.xlsx文件,如果你试图读取或写入其他格式的文件,会出现错误。
3. Excel文件被锁定:如果Excel文件正在被另一个程序或用户打开,xlsx包可能无法读取或写入文件,并会出现错误。
4. 缺少依赖项:xlsx包依赖于其他R软件包,例如rJava和xlsxjars。如果这些软件包没有正确安装或加载,xlsx包可能无法正常工作并出现错误。
为了更好地解决你的问题,请提供更具体的错误信息和你的代码。另外,你可以查看官方文档和相关论坛,寻找解决问题的方法。
阅读全文